Industry Overview

The global vaccine market was valued at USD   76,955.0 Mn in 2025 and is estimated to reach USD   81,402.9 Mn in 2026, reflecting a growth rate of 5.9%. Gaining growth because rising infectious disease outbreaks with increasing concern related to antimicrobial resistance. Even expanding adult and pediatric immunization programs and growing pandemic preparedness requirements has created intensifying demand. It includes sector such as public health agencies, pharmaceutical companies, defense healthcare, and travel medicine sectors. Rising advancement in technologies which lead to adoption of mRNA-based vaccines with recombinant vaccine platforms and advanced antigen discovery technologies supports faster vaccine development. This significantly improved manufacturing scalability to enhance immunization coverage for strengthen global health security has accelerate vaccine adoption across healthcare systems worldwide.

Factors Shaping the Next Decade

Market Gaps / Restraints: High capital required for enhancing vaccine development with complex regulatory approval pathways and cold-chain infrastructure limitations remain key restraints particularly across low- and middle-income countries.

Key Trends and Innovations: Industry is witness for transformation towards adapting innovations such as self-amplifying mRNA platforms and personalized neoantigen cancer vaccines introduced through recent development programs. Even advanced intranasal vaccine formulations and thermostable vaccine technologies are improving immune response and manufacturing flexibility supporting broader vaccine accessibility and commercialization.

Potential Opportunities: Development of universal respiratory virus vaccines and deployment of preventive vaccines for chronic non-communicable diseases could generate new revenue streams.

Regulatory Environment and Policy Support

Government Regulations & Supportive Policies: Global vaccine manufacturers align with the World Health Organization (WHO) Prequalification Programme and the European Medicines Agency (EMA) Vaccine Regulatory Strategy 2025–2028. It is significantly ensuring standardized vaccine quality with safety and efficacy requirements. These frameworks strengthen global vaccine access to accelerate commercialization of innovative vaccine technologies.

Key Government Initiatives: Initiatives such as the U.S. Project NextGen and the Canada Biomanufacturing and Life Sciences Strategy support vaccine R&D. In this way government contributing to expansion of domestic manufacturing and next-generation vaccine platform development for driving long-term market growth and supply resilience.
